First Five Things to Do After Your Child Is Diagnosed with Down Syndrome

By Terri Mauro, About.com

1: READ this message for new parents to get a little more hopeful outlook.

2: BUY Babies with Down Syndrome, a new parent's guide. Compare Prices

3: SEARCH for organizations and resources in your area on the National Down Syndrome Society's site.

4: JOIN UpsNDowns or another e-mail support group to share ideas and feelings with fellow parents.

5: VISIT our listing of Down syndrome links for more information and ideas.
